Gamestop Now Offering Military Discount On New And Used Games

GameStop looks to celebrate Veterans Day through the introduction of a new military discount program meant to salute the brave men and women who have served or are currently serving in the United States. Beginning today, a 10% discount will be given to all active and former military personnel off new video game software and accessories, pre-owned software, hardware, and accessories, and all collectibles across U.S. store locations. The program will be available all year for all military personnel with appropriate IS, which can include a military of Veterans ID, Form DD214, or by authenticating their military status through other online verification platforms like ID....

Genshin Impact Next Banner And Current Banners List Of All Banners In Genshin Impact

Genshin Impact Banners are what you can spend your Fate currency on to Wish for characters and weapons. Every character event Banner usually runs for three weeks, making way for the next Banner, which always has a single 5-Star character with boosted pull odds, and three boosted 4-Stars. There is also a weapon Banner that changes its featured 5-Star and 4-Star pulls every three weeks, and two permanent Banners with their own unique character and weapon pools....

Get Your Free Ps4 Batman V Superman Dynamic Theme

A free Batman v Superman: Dawn of Justice dynamic theme is now available to download on PS4. The 26.9MB download will transform your PS4 home screen with a specially themed Batman v Superman theme, changing the background, icons and colours. Once downloaded you can select the Batman v Superman theme via the Themes option in Settings. Source: PlayStation Store
